Raspberry Sundae Peony is a delightful and deliciously named garden classic that offers a double helping of beauty in late spring. Its large, bomb-type double flowers open to reveal a captivating blend of creamy white outer petals encircling a fluffy center of soft pink and raspberry-red petaloids. The delightful fragrance adds to the sensory experience. This reliable, herbaceous perennial forms a handsome mound of deep green foliage that provides structure in the border long after the spectacular blooms have faded, returning bigger and better each year with minimal care.

  • Bicolored Double Blooms: Features large, fragrant, double flowers with a unique raspberry-and-vanilla color scheme—creamy white outer petals surrounding a center blush of soft pink and raspberry-red.

  • Sweet, Light Fragrance: Emits a pleasant, classic peony fragrance that enhances its appeal in the garden and as a cut flower.

  • Reliable Herbaceous Perennial: Dies back to the ground in winter and re-emerges each spring, growing stronger and producing more blooms as it matures over the years.

  • Low-Maintenance & Deer Resistant: Once established, it is remarkably carefree, requiring no staking and is naturally resistant to deer, rabbits, and most pests.

  • Excellent Cut Flower: The strong stems and long-lasting, fragrant blooms make it a premier choice for stunning, luxurious bouquets.

Quick facts
  • Features:Foliage: Deeply lobed, narrow, glossy, dark green leaves that provide an attractive backdrop and remain handsome throughout the growing season. The stems are sturdy and a reddish-green color.Flowers: Large, double, bomb-type flowers with a unique color pattern. The outer petals are soft pink to creamy white, while the center forms a fluffy mound of shorter, raspberry-pink petals, creating a delightful "sundae" effect. The flowers are fragrant.Habit: A herbaceous (non-woody), clump-forming perennial with a strong, upright, and bushy growth habit.
  • Mature Height: 2-3 ft.
    Mature Width: 2-3 ft.
  • Growth Rate: Moderate (takes 2-3 years to establish fully)
  • Light Needs: Full sun (At least 6 hours of direct sun for best flowering)
  • Key Advantages:Unique and stunning bicolor flowers.Excellent cut flower with a lovely fragrance.Very long-lived and low maintenance once established.Deer and rabbit resistant.Cold hardy
  • Landscape Uses:Mixed perennial borders.Cut flower gardens.Specimen plant in the garden.Foundation plantings
FAQs

Q: Does it need support (staking)?
A: Its stems are quite strong for a double peony, but the large, heavy blooms can still benefit from a low peony ring or informal staking, especially after rain, to keep them perfectly upright.

Q: How long does it take to establish and bloom well?
A: Patience is key. It may take 2-3 years after planting to produce a full display of blooms. Avoid planting too deep—the "eyes" (pink buds on the root) should be no more than 2 inches below the soil surface.
